Lot Description

A pair of German decorative spoons, each with a leaf moulded bowl and slim stem leading to a terminal decorated with a winged cherub's head and foliate motifs, struck to reverse with the crown and crescent mark, 800 and a maker's mark, possibly for Mayer & Fuchs;  together with various other continental flatware to include a set of six teaspoons with zoomorphic terminals, a Chinese export spoon with a long part spiral twist stem, marked Tuckchang (Tuck Chang & Co.) to reverse, a pickle fork, three other teaspoons, two with oriental marks, and a set of six table forks.  Gross weighable silver 8.17 ozt (254 grams) (19).

The items in the lot are in varied condition but all display general surface scratches, marks, wear and tarnishing commensurate with the age and use.  Various nicks and pitting marks in the metal.  The Chinese export spoon has some heavier tarnishing.  Spoon bowls have generally faired quite well.  Various struck marks to pieces, some are legible and some are more difficult to read.
